How to fill out request for proposal

How to fill out RE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L
01
Begin with a clear title: Label your document as 'Request for Proposal' (RFP).
02
Introduction: Provide an overview of your organization and the purpose of the RFP.
03
Project description: Clearly outline the project, its objectives, and desired outcomes.
04
Scope of work: Define the specific services or products needed.
05
Timeline: Include deadlines for proposal submissions, project milestones, and completion dates.
06
Budget: Provide an estimated budget range or required pricing format.
07
Evaluation criteria: Explain how proposals will be assessed and the criteria that will be used.
08
Submission guidelines: Detail how and where to submit proposals, including required formats and any necessary documentation.
09
Questions and clarifications: Offer a point of contact for any inquiries related to the RFP.
10
Closing statement: Thank potential bidders for their interest and encourage them to submit proposals.

What is RE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L?
A Request for Proposal (RFP) is a document that solicits proposals from potential vendors to provide products or services. It outlines the project's requirements, goals, and criteria for selection.
Who is required to file RE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L?
Organizations or businesses that need to procure goods or services from external vendors and that seek competitive bids are required to file an RFP.
How to fill out RE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L?
To fill out an RFP, you should include sections such as the project overview, detailed specifications, evaluation criteria, submission guidelines, and deadlines. You must ensure clarity and provide all necessary information to allow vendors to create accurate proposals.
What is the purpose of RE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L?
The purpose of an RFP is to invite vendors to submit proposals that demonstrate how their products or services can meet the needs of the organization, allowing for comparison of capabilities and costs.
What information must be reported on RE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L?
An RFP must report information such as project scope, budget, timeline, evaluation criteria, submission requirements, and any legal or compliance constraints.
